The Perfect Structure for a Student Chapter Letter of Recommendation

Are you tasked with writing a letter of recommendation for a student chapter? It’s important to make sure that your letter is organized and effective in highlighting the student’s strengths and achievements. Here is a template for creating a successful letter of recommendation:

Introduction
In the first paragraph, introduce yourself and explain how you know the student. Include details such as the student’s name, their position within the student chapter, and the length of time you have known them.

Student’s Accomplishments
Next, provide a brief overview of the student’s accomplishments within the student chapter. Highlight any leadership roles they have held, projects they have completed, and any awards or recognition they have received.

Personal Characteristics
In this section, give specific examples of the student’s personal characteristics that make them a strong candidate for the opportunity they are applying for. These could include qualities such as determination, work ethic, creativity, and communication skills. Include anecdotes or instances that illustrate these traits.

Academic Achievements
If the student has excelled academically, mention this in the letter. Provide details such as their GPA, any relevant coursework, and any academic awards or honors they have received.

Conclusion
In the final paragraph, summarize your glowing recommendation for the student. State the confidence you have in their ability to succeed and the positive impact they will make in the field. Finally, include your contact information so that the reader can follow up with any additional questions.

By following this simple structure, you will create a letter of recommendation that showcases the student’s strengths and qualifications. Good luck!

Tips for Writing a Letter of Recommendation Template for a Student Chapter

Writing a letter of recommendation for a student chapter can be a daunting task, but it’s also a great opportunity to help someone stand out and achieve their academic and professional goals. Here are some tips for creating an effective letter of recommendation template:

  • Be honest and specific: A good letter of recommendation should speak to the student’s specific skills, accomplishments, and character. Avoid using vague or generic language and focus on concrete examples of the student’s achievements. Be honest about their strengths and weaknesses, and include specific anecdotes that demonstrate their abilities.
  • Use strong language: When it comes to writing a letter of recommendation, strong language is key. Use active verbs and powerful adjectives to describe the student’s achievements and qualities. Avoid overly flowery language or platitudes, but don’t be afraid to use bold, positive language to really make the student stand out.
  • Focus on the relevant: When writing a letter of recommendation for a student chapter, it’s important to focus on the qualities and skills that are most relevant to their goals. For example, if the student is applying for a leadership position, focus on their leadership abilities and experiences. If they’re applying for a scholarship, emphasize their academic achievements and work ethic.
  • Keep it succinct: While it’s important to be specific and detailed in your letter, it’s also important to keep it concise and to the point. A good letter of recommendation should be no longer than a page, and should avoid excessive or unnecessary detail. Stick to the most important points and include examples that illustrate your points.
  • Proofread and edit: Finally, make sure to proofread and edit your letter carefully before sending it off. Typos, grammatical errors, and formatting issues can detract from the effectiveness of the letter, so take the time to read it over carefully and make any necessary changes. If possible, have someone else read it over as well to catch any errors you might have missed.

By following these tips, you can create a powerful letter of recommendation that can help a student chapter member achieve their goals and stand out in the competitive worlds of academia and professional development.
